About
Steve has been practicing law since 2002 and has broad range of legal experience. Steve began his legal career representing homeowners and homeowner associations in complex construction defect matters, including several class action lawsuits, mass action lawsuits and indemnity/bad faith lawsuits.
Steve has focused his practice for several years on personal injury and wrongful death. He has successfully helped his clients recover millions of dollars in compensation. He truly enjoys representing clients who have been hurt in collisions and helping navigate the process and helping level the playing field against insurance companies.
Steve also enjoys working with clients to meet their estate planning needs (including Wills and Trusts) along with non-profit and church law.
Steve graduated magna cum laude from the Northern Arizona University with a Bachelor of Science in Exercise Science with an emphasis on injury biomechanics. He subsequently graduated from the University of San Diego School of Law.
Steve is an Arizona native who lives in Waddell, Arizona with his wife and children. In addition to his dedication to his clients, Steve aspires to be a devoted husband to his bride Angie, faithful father to his children, and most of all humble bondservant of the Lord Jesus Christ. In his extra time Steve helps coach track & field and he also enjoys mountain biking, hiking and spending time in the great outdoors.

Jurisdictional Context
Why local counsel matters in Arizona
Practicing law in Arizona. Legal matters in Arizona are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Glendale are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Arizona state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Arizona br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Arizona cour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
